Tunnels never did manzai, and started off more as a monomane/gag duo. They were incredibly popular in the 80s and managed to obtain over 30% of the ratings nationwide with their shows (which is incredibly hard, for any show) and having seen their earlier works and Tunnels Mina-san okagedeshita, and Kuwazugirai, I can say I love those shows more than Downtown’s gottsu ee Kanjii and Gaki no tsukai.
